Blue Raster named a pre-qualified vendor for the purpose of providing GIS, cloud, and IT support to the North Carolina Department of Information Technology
Arlington, VA – April 21, 2023 - Blue Raster has been named a pre-qualified vendor for Geographic Information Systems (GIS) IT Specialty Services by the North Carolina Department of Information Technology (NCDIT). The contract is intended to develop a relationship between pre-qualified vendors and the state to provide information technology specialty services through subsequently issued Statements of Work for state agencies, community colleges, institutions, counties, municipalities, public schools, and other local government entities. Under this contract, Blue Raster has been approved to provide GIS, IT application development, cloud implementation, and cloud integration services.
To achieve pre-qualification, Blue Raster had to undergo an extensive and competitive application process in which specialty projects completed by each candidate were compared against current and hopeful pre-qualified vendors. The list was chosen out of over 70 new applicants.
